Multiple Choice Questions 1. A valid out-of-state license is accepted as the basis for issuing a license in a second state without reexamination. This is called: A. certification B. accreditation C. registration D. reciprocity E. endorsement Reciprocity is when a second state accepts the first state’s credentials for licensing a health care provider. Certification, registration, and accreditation are not licensure methods. Endorsement is on a case-by-case basis and infrequently used.
